Key Cost Influences
Storm window replacement in Redondo Beach, CA, involves updating or installing secondary windows to improve insulation, reduce noise, and enhance energy efficiency. Understanding typical project components can help in planning and comparing options for your property.
- Materials: Options include aluminum, vinyl, or wood frames, with glass or acrylic panels suited for coastal conditions.
- Size and Scope: Projects can range from replacing a few individual windows to upgrading entire building sections, depending on the property’s needs.
- Labor Complexity: Installation varies based on window size, existing frame condition, and accessibility, impacting overall labor effort.
- Permitting: Local regulations in Redondo Beach may require permits for window replacements, especially for multi-family or commercial buildings.
- Additional Options: Upgrades such as screens, energy-efficient glass, or decorative finishes can be included to enhance functionality and appearance.
